文章 2023-06-28 来自:开发者社区

【三十天精通Vue 3】第七天 Vue 3 响应式系统详解

引言Vue 3 响应式系统是 Vue 3 新引入的一个概念,它仍然是基于 Vue 2 中的响应式系统,但与 Vue 2 的响应式系统相比,Vue 3 的响应式系统更加强大和灵活。今天,我们将详细介绍 Vue 3 响应式系统的各个方面,包括数据绑定、响应式数据、虚拟 DOM、事件处理、插件系统和常见问题及解决方案。一、Vue 3 响应式系统概述1.1 响应式系统的简介响应式系统是指当数据发生改变时....

文章 2023-05-07 来自:开发者社区

实现最精简的响应式系统来学习Vue的data、computed、watch源码

导读记得初学Vue源码的时候,在defineReactive、Observer、Dep、Watcher等等内部设计源码之间跳来跳去,发现再也绕不出来了。Vue发展了很久,很多fix和feature的增加让内部源码越来越庞大,太多的边界情况和优化设计掩盖了原本精简的代码设计,让新手阅读源码变得越来越困难,但是面试的时候,Vue的响应式原理几乎成了Vue技术栈的公司面试中高级前端必问的点之一。这篇文....

实现最精简的响应式系统来学习Vue的data、computed、watch源码
文章 2023-01-04 来自:开发者社区

简单实现 vue 中的响应式系统

1. 什么是响应式?响应式最基本的理解就是可以自动响应数据变化的代码机制。比如:下面这段代码,初始化了一个m变量,第2行代码使用了m,那么在m有一个新值得时候,第2行代码要可以自动重新执行。示例1:let m = 20 console.log(m) m = 40对象的响应式// 响应式对象 let obj = { name: 'yjw' } // 打印obj.name coneole...

简单实现 vue 中的响应式系统
文章 2022-12-05 来自:开发者社区

Vue3响应式系统中reactive的简易实现

一、什么是响应式数据?举个子const data = { text: 'Hello, 掘金!' } function effect() { document.title = data.text; } effect() 复制代码在上述代码中,我们的effect函数中的操作依赖于data.text,运行之后,标签页标题会变成”Hello, 掘金“,我们知道当修改data数据之后,标签页标题是...

文章 2022-10-19 来自:开发者社区

如何理解Vue的响应式系统

部分内容参考官方文档MVVMM: model数据模型, V:view视图模型, VM: viewModel视图数据模型双向:视图变化了, 数据自动更新 => 监听原生的事件即可, 输入框变了, 监听输入框input事件数据变化了, 视图要自动更新 => vue2 和 vue3基本原理vue2.0 数据劫持: Object.defineProperty (es5)vue3.0 数据劫持....

如何理解Vue的响应式系统
文章 2022-08-22 来自:开发者社区

Vue3源码学习(3):reactive + effect + track + trigger 实现响应式系统

回顾上篇文章,我们实现了 reactive 方法,它内部采用了 Proxy 来实现对象属性操作的拦截。这是实现响应式系统的前提,我们必须先拦截到用户对属性的访问,之后才能做依赖收集;再拦截到用户对属性的修改,才能做派发更新。effect 方法基本用法如果之前了解过 Vue2 的响应式原理,那么对于 Watcher 你一定不会陌生。它是 Vue2 响应式系统中的核心之一,无论是响应式数据,还是 c....

Vue3源码学习(3):reactive + effect + track + trigger 实现响应式系统
问答 2019-11-24 来自:开发者社区

你是如何理解Vue的响应式系统的?

你是如何理解Vue的响应式系统的? 【精品问答】前端面试手册 【精品问答】前端面试手册之Vue篇

文章 2018-06-29 来自:开发者社区

我是这么理解Vue中的响应式系统的

遇到知识,尤其是复杂的概念,我不能类比的话,我很难接收(所以学习很差...)。在看了大神染陌同学的Vue源码解析后,我想分享一下我所类比的Vue响应式系统,您得先看他的文章(至少看他写的Vue的响应式)。 这是我自己的想法,或许适合您,或许也不适合您,还望多多指点。本文没有代码。 在此之前就当您看过《生化危机》。 我是这样理解vue中的响应式系统原理的:  new Vue({option...

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

阿里巴巴终端技术

阿里巴巴终端技术最新内容汇聚在此,由阿里巴巴终端委员会官方运营。阿里巴巴终端委员会是阿里集团面向前端、客户端的虚拟技术组织。我们的愿景是着眼用户体验前沿、技术创新引领业界,将面向未来,制定技术策略和目标并落地执行,推动终端技术发展,帮助工程师成长,打造顶级的终端体验。同时我们运营着阿里巴巴终端域的官方公众号:阿里巴巴终端技术,欢迎关注。

+关注